- [ ] Step 7: Archive cold storage buckets (Glacierline tier). Confirm both ceremony witnesses are present, verify bucket manifests match the Oxbow ledger, then seal the archive key shares. Plugin authors may observe but not handle shares. Once sealed, the archive index itself is encrypted and can only be reopened with the passphrase below.

vault phrase of badup-hahig = tamael-aldael-kelmir-istael-fenok-istwyn-tamius-jorath-oliion

Runbook 7.3 — Inter-office transfer of signed contracts

Signed originals from the Westmere office move to Dunholm headquarters every Friday. Place contracts in the tamper-evident pouch, record the seal number in the transfer ledger, and have a second staff member witness the sealing. The pouch travels in the locked document case, never loose in a bag. On arrival, Dunholm reception verifies the seal before signing acceptance. The confidential courier hand-over instruction is maintained separately and appears immediately below this section.

dispatch memo: the lamwyn fenwyn courier leaves the wenir ledger at gate 7175 under passcode 822969

Onboarding note — Bouncewright bounce processor. The service polls the inbound queue, classifies hard and soft bounces, and suppresses addresses after three hard failures. On-call duties: watch the suppression lag dashboard and restart the classifier if lag exceeds ten minutes. Local setup requires the worker env file in the repo root; copy env.sample, set the queue region to plover-east, and then add the signing secret on the next line.

vault entry, yahif-yajep: COURIER_KEY29=b802bdf8034096b65a51c6ba5abe2

This alert fires when the Brambledb maintenance job fails to create next month's partition for the events table before the 25th. Without the new partition, inserts dated in the coming month will be rejected at rollover, causing ingest failures across the Quillfeather pipeline. The fix is usually rerunning the partition-create job manually; it is idempotent and safe to repeat. Verify the partition exists afterward with the standard check query. Step-by-step remediation instructions are on the internal page below.

wiki page, tahaf-tajog: https://jira.ordindyn.corp/pipeline